package controllers
import (
"encoding/json"
"log/slog"
"net/http"
"github.com/gorilla/mux"
gErrors "github.com/cloudbase/garm-provider-common/errors"
"github.com/cloudbase/garm/params"
)
// swagger:route POST /github/endpoints endpoints CreateGithubEndpoint
//
// Create a GitHub Endpoint.
//
// Parameters:
// + name: Body
// description: Parameters used when creating a GitHub endpoint.
// type: CreateGithubEndpointParams
// in: body
// required: true
//
// Responses:
// 200: ForgeEndpoint
// default: APIErrorResponse
func (a *APIController) CreateGithubEndpoint(w http.ResponseWriter, r *http.Request) {
ctx := r.Context()
var params params.CreateGithubEndpointParams
if err := json.NewDecoder(r.Body).Decode(&params); err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to decode request")
handleError(ctx, w, gErrors.ErrBadRequest)
return
}
endpoint, err := a.r.CreateGithubEndpoint(ctx, params)
if err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to create GitHub endpoint")
handleError(ctx, w, err)
return
}
w.Header().Set("Content-Type", "application/json")
if err := json.NewEncoder(w).Encode(endpoint); err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to encode response")
}
}
// swagger:route GET /github/endpoints endpoints ListGithubEndpoints
//
// List all GitHub Endpoints.
//
// Responses:
// 200: ForgeEndpoints
// default: APIErrorResponse
func (a *APIController) ListGithubEndpoints(w http.ResponseWriter, r *http.Request) {
ctx := r.Context()
endpoints, err := a.r.ListGithubEndpoints(ctx)
if err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to list GitHub endpoints")
handleError(ctx, w, err)
return
}
w.Header().Set("Content-Type", "application/json")
if err := json.NewEncoder(w).Encode(endpoints); err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to encode response")
}
}
// swagger:route GET /github/endpoints/{name} endpoints GetGithubEndpoint
//
// Get a GitHub Endpoint.
//
// Parameters:
// + name: name
// description: The name of the GitHub endpoint.
// type: string
// in: path
// required: true
//
// Responses:
// 200: ForgeEndpoint
// default: APIErrorResponse
func (a *APIController) GetGithubEndpoint(w http.ResponseWriter, r *http.Request) {
ctx := r.Context()
vars := mux.Vars(r)
name, ok := vars["name"]
if !ok {
slog.ErrorContext(ctx, "missing name in request")
handleError(ctx, w, gErrors.ErrBadRequest)
return
}
endpoint, err := a.r.GetGithubEndpoint(ctx, name)
if err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to get GitHub endpoint")
handleError(ctx, w, err)
return
}
w.Header().Set("Content-Type", "application/json")
if err := json.NewEncoder(w).Encode(endpoint); err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to encode response")
}
}
// swagger:route DELETE /github/endpoints/{name} endpoints DeleteGithubEndpoint
//
// Delete a GitHub Endpoint.
//
// Parameters:
// + name: name
// description: The name of the GitHub endpoint.
// type: string
// in: path
// required: true
//
// Responses:
// default: APIErrorResponse
func (a *APIController) DeleteGithubEndpoint(w http.ResponseWriter, r *http.Request) {
ctx := r.Context()
vars := mux.Vars(r)
name, ok := vars["name"]
if !ok {
slog.ErrorContext(ctx, "missing name in request")
handleError(ctx, w, gErrors.ErrBadRequest)
return
}
if err := a.r.DeleteGithubEndpoint(ctx, name); err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to delete GitHub endpoint")
handleError(ctx, w, err)
return
}
w.WriteHeader(http.StatusNoContent)
}
// swagger:route PUT /github/endpoints/{name} endpoints UpdateGithubEndpoint
//
// Update a GitHub Endpoint.
//
// Parameters:
// + name: name
// description: The name of the GitHub endpoint.
// type: string
// in: path
// required: true
// + name: Body
// description: Parameters used when updating a GitHub endpoint.
// type: UpdateGithubEndpointParams
// in: body
// required: true
//
// Responses:
// 200: ForgeEndpoint
// default: APIErrorResponse
func (a *APIController) UpdateGithubEndpoint(w http.ResponseWriter, r *http.Request) {
ctx := r.Context()
vars := mux.Vars(r)
name, ok := vars["name"]
if !ok {
slog.ErrorContext(ctx, "missing name in request")
handleError(ctx, w, gErrors.ErrBadRequest)
return
}
var params params.UpdateGithubEndpointParams
if err := json.NewDecoder(r.Body).Decode(&params); err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to decode request")
handleError(ctx, w, gErrors.ErrBadRequest)
return
}
endpoint, err := a.r.UpdateGithubEndpoint(ctx, name, params)
if err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to update GitHub endpoint")
handleError(ctx, w, err)
return
}
w.Header().Set("Content-Type", "application/json")
if err := json.NewEncoder(w).Encode(endpoint); err != nil {
slog.With(slog.Any("error", err)).ErrorContext(ctx, "failed to encode response")
}
}
